Comments
|
Palau remains my favorite dive location worldwide. Aggressor provides a dependable, if somewhat structured, week of excellent liveaboard diving in this splendid region. Crew, particularly Captain Jeff and divemaster/photographer Doug were extraordinarily friendly, helpful and fun to be with. Local crew members were terrific sources of information and equally friendly. The food was a little disappointing because of the lack of fresh fish available the week we were there. Kitchen did very well with what they had and you never get a chance to be hungry. Warm towels on the dive deck when you get out of the water. Skiff is raised and lowered hydraulically at rear dive deck so access is the best of any liveaboard I have done. Don't bother taking sweats for cool evenings if you go in the spring. . .it never got cool. Palau is a long way away and merits sticking around or tagging on another location since you have to fly so far to get there, but don't miss this place. The Aggressor trip is a bit pricey but worth every penny of it. |
